Courts in one state might look to frequent-regulation decisions from the courts of other states where the reasoning in an identical case is persuasive. This will occur in “cases of first impression,” a fact sample or state of affairs that the courts in one state have never seen before. But if the supreme court in a specific state has already dominated on a sure kind of case, lower courts in that state will all the time follow the rule set forth by their highest court.
On a extra native stage, counties and municipal companies or townships could also be approved underneath a state’s structure to create or undertake ordinances. Examples of ordinances include native building codes, zoning laws, and misdemeanors or infractions such as skateboarding or jaywalking. Most of the extra unusual laws which are in the information every so often are native ordinances. For instance, in Logan County, Colorado, it is unlawful to kiss a sleeping lady; in Indianapolis, Indiana, and Eureka, Nebraska, it’s a crime to kiss in case you have a mustache. As a way to prevail in a negligence action, the plaintiff must show, by a preponderance of the evidence , the following four elements: (1) that the defendant owed the plaintiff a duty of care; (2) that the defendant breached that responsibility; (3) that the defendant’s breach of his or her responsibility of care brought on the plaintiff’s damage; (four) that the plaintiff suffered damage.
